Forever Living Products Cleveland - Hours & Locations
Forever Living Products - Cleveland
6876 Pearl Road, Cleveland OH 44130 Phone Number:(440) 884-3114Hours may fluctuate
Distance:9.30 miles
Hours may fluctuate